What You Will Be Doing
Our professionals are the most important resource in our service commitment to our customers. We nurture a progressive environment where challenging, empowered, and purposeful work is celebrated.
As the City Secretary, you will provide comprehensive administrative support to the City Council, including maintaining and certifying official public records, reports, minutes, and historical documents. Responsibilities also include engrossing and enrolling laws, resolutions, and ordinances, posting public notices, safeguarding the City Seal, and overseeing the coordination of City elections. Additionally, the City Secretary directs and manages department staff and oversees records management operations.

What You Bring To Us
- Bachelor's degree in Public Administration, Business Administration, Records Management or related field ,and five (5) years municipal administration experience, two (2) years of which are in a managerial or supervisory role; or equivalent combination of education and experience.
- Possession of the Texas Registered Municipal Clerk Certificate with Texas Municipal Clerks Association required.
- Certified Municipal Clerk Certification with International Institute of Municipal Clerks Association preferred.
